Gironde: Diabetic, Youenn will travel across Europe by train this summer

At 19 and with only his backpack for company, Youenn Rollin, who has just finished his high school years in Bazas (Gironde), is going to discover Europe. (©The Republican)

“I want to show that it is possible. That diabetes is not an obstacle to the realization of ambitious projects. From the height of his 19 springs, Youenn Rollin knows what he wants. The young man, type 1 diabetic since the age of twelve, is preparing for a great adventure.

This summer, this resident of Bazas (Gironde) will travel across Europe by train. Departure scheduled for 1is next August. Brussels, Amsterdam, Paderborn, Copenhagen, Malmö, Prague, Zagreb, Lausanne, Barcelona are some of its destinations. “All train tickets are reserved, smiles the South-Girondin. Everything is timed. Because I have to be in La Rochelle between August 28 and 29, just before I start university. »

“Finding myself in front of myself, I like it”

This journey is above all a great challenge for Youenn, who has lived with diabetes since adolescence. Sensors to control blood sugar, insulin…

“With me, I bring everything you need,” said the Bazadais. Who still remembers very well the day when the disease was discovered.

In the middle of football training, I had a stomach ache. I couldn’t move, I just wanted to sleep… And I had the worst night of my life.

Youenn Rollininhabitant of Bazas

Over the years, Youenn made his diabetes a strength. “It helped me,” he says. Without diabetes, I wouldn’t be the man I am today. In the end, I lived well with my diabetes. But you have to be honest, when you’re younger and you have to get your injections in the canteen, it’s more complicated…

An accomplished sportsman, Youenn is a member of the US Bazas Athlétisme. And once he puts on his shoes, his shorts and his blue jersey, nothing stops our apprentice adventurer. Who loves to gallop and who achieves remarkable times. “Two years ago, I started running again and it helps my balance,” he explains. It’s amazing the effects it can have on blood sugar. »

Certainly, his journey, he will not do it on foot. But this represents, despite everything, a large expenditure of energy. And, faced with the challenge that awaits him, the interested party wants to settle everything down to the smallest detail.

I’ve been preparing all this for months, My goal is really to use as little money as possible. I have always loved travel. And doing one on my own was one of my dreams.

Youenn Rollininhabitant of Bazas

Maybe it’s all in the genes… Because at the age of 16, his father had the somewhat absurd idea of ​​hitchhiking across France. “I like the idea of ​​coming face to face with yourself,” he says, with a big smile. When I broke the news to my friends, they thought it was great. »

In total immersion

Because beyond visiting those which are among the most beautiful cities of the Old Continent, Youenn Rollin intends to discover the local populations.

An immersion that he wishes to be complete. Closer to local people, despite the language barrier. “I’ll manage, he laughs. I want to totally immerse myself, sleep with the locals. In English, even though I don’t have an amazing accent, I manage. For Spanish, we’ll see… If I have to go door to door, because I need something, I’ll go door to door. This is not a problem ! »

Some apprehensions…

But this motivation and this overflowing desire hide some apprehensions… An example? “In Sweden, embraces Youenn, I know that the signs are not in English, just in Swedish. So, it will be necessary to find one’s bearings and get on the right train so that I don’t end up in the wrong country. »

Now, Youenn Rollin is counting the days that separate him from the big departure. “I can’t wait to get on the first train to Brussels. » The countdown begins. Have a good trip !
